ALARMS
Messages, causes and corrective actions
Anomalies, codes and remedies
MESSAGE CAUSE ACTION TO TAKE
NO ALARMS All works regularly
//
MAX ALARM The flow rate is higher than the maximum threshold set
Check the maximum flow rate threshold set and
the process conditions
MIN ALARM The flow rate is lower than the minimum threshold set
Check the minimum flow rate threshold set and
the process conditions
FLOW RATE >FS
The flow rate is higher than the full scale value set on the
instrument
Check the full scale value set on the instrument
and the process conditions
PULSE/FREQ>FS
The pulse generation output of the device is saturated and can
not generate the sufficient number of pulses
Set a bigger volume unit or, if the connected
counting device allows it, reduce the pulse
duration value
EMPTY PIPE
The measuring pipe is empty or the detection system has not
been properly calibrated
Check whether the pipe is empty, or repeat the
empty pipe calibration procedure
INPUT NOISY
The measure is strongly effected by external noise or the
connecting cable from converter to the sensor may be broken
Check the status cables connecting the converter
to the sensor, the devices grounding connections
or the possible presence of noise sources
EXCITATION
FAIL
The coils or the cable connecting the sensor are interrupted Check the connecting cables to the sensor
CURR. LOOP
OPEN
The 4-20mA output on board or the optional one are not
correctly closed on a valid load
Verify the load is applied to the output (max 1000
Ω).
To disable the alarm, set the “mA VAL.FAULT”
value (menu alarm) to 0.
P.SUPPLY FAIL Power supply different from that indicated on the label
Verify that the power supply is as indicated on the
label
